F. Crestani et al., "Is this document relevant? ... probably": A survey of probabilistic models in information retrieval, ACM C SURV, 30(4), 1998, pp. 528-552
This article surveys probabilistic approaches to modeling information retri
eval. The basic concepts of probabilistic approaches to information retriev
al are outlined and the principles and assumptions upon which the approache
s are based are presented. The various models proposed in the development o
f IR are described, classified, and compared using a common formalism. New
approaches that constitute the basis of future research are described.
